          <text>&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Canal Conveyance Capacity Restoration Act&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p&gt;This bill authorizes the Bureau of Reclamation to provide financial assistance for various projects in California to mitigate the sinking or settling of the ground (i.e., subsidence mitigation), specifically for projects related to the Friant-Kern Canal, the Delta-Mendota Canal, and certain parts of the San Luis Canal/California Aqueduct.&lt;/p&gt;</text>
